About this book

The Complete Handbook of Microphone Preamps is the definitive, practical reference for anyone who relies on clean, accurate signal capture—from studio engineers and live sound techs to podcasters and video producers. This is not a marketing piece; it is a working manual that explains what preamps actually do, why the specs matter, and how to make the right choice for your specific microphones and workflows. You'll learn how to read a spec sheet for real-world meaning, how to properly integrate a preamp into a signal chain, and how to avoid the classic pitfalls that ruin a good recording.

Beyond selection and setup, this book is a field guide for the long-term owner. It provides detailed maintenance routines and step-by-step troubleshooting procedures for the most common failures—from no output and excessive noise to intermittent connections and phantom power issues. You will also find an entire chapter on the business of preamps, covering everything from servicing and private-labeling to rental strategies and consulting. This makes the book an essential resource not just for engineers, but for anyone looking to build a business in pro audio.

The final sections look forward. What is the impact of digital control and networking? How do new manufacturing materials and components change the market? What resale value can you expect? Written in a clear, neutral, and instructional style, this handbook is designed to be read cover-to-cover or kept on the shelf for when you need a specific answer. It is the resource we wish we had when we started, and it's the one you'll keep for your entire career.
